2011-2013 Mercedes-Benz E-class T-modell (S212) E 250 CDI BlueEFFICIENCY (204 Hp) Start & Stop

The Mercedes-Benz E-Class T-modell (S212) E 250 CDI BlueEFFICIENCY, produced from February 2011 to January 2013, represented a compelling blend of practicality, efficiency, and luxury within the E-Class range. Positioned as a mid-range offering in the T-modell (estate) body style, this variant catered to buyers seeking a spacious and refined vehicle with strong fuel economy and respectable performance. It was part of the S212 series, the third generation of E-Class estates, known for its elegant design and advanced engineering. The “BlueEFFICIENCY” designation signified Mercedes-Benz’s efforts to optimize fuel consumption and reduce emissions through various technological enhancements.

Technical Specifications

Brand Mercedes-Benz
Model E-Class
Generation E-Class T-modell (S212)
Type E 250 CDI BlueEFFICIENCY (204 Hp) Start & Stop
Start of production February, 2011
End of production January, 2013
Powertrain Architecture Internal Combustion engine
Body type Station wagon (estate)
Seats 5
Doors 5
Fuel consumption (urban) 6.5-6.6 l/100 km (36.2 – 35.6 US mpg, 43.5 – 42.8 UK mpg, 15.4 – 15.2 km/l)
Fuel consumption (extra urban) 4.4-4.6 l/100 km (53.5 – 51.1 US mpg, 64.2 – 61.4 UK mpg, 22.7 – 21.7 km/l)
Fuel consumption (combined) 5.2-5.4 l/100 km (45.2 – 43.6 US mpg, 54.3 – 52.3 UK mpg, 19.2 – 18.5 km/l)
CO2 emissions 136-141 g/km
Fuel Type Diesel
Acceleration 0 – 100 km/h 7.8 sec
Acceleration 0 – 62 mph 7.8 sec
Acceleration 0 – 60 mph 7.4 sec
Maximum speed 232 km/h (144.16 mph)
Emission standard Euro 5
Weight-to-power ratio 8.7 kg/Hp, 115.3 Hp/tonne
Weight-to-torque ratio 3.5 kg/Nm, 282.5 Nm/tonne
Power 204 Hp @ 4200 rpm
Power per litre 95.2 Hp/l
Torque 500 Nm @ 1600-1800 rpm (368.78 lb.-ft. @ 1600-1800 rpm)
Engine layout Front, Longitudinal
Engine Model/Code OM 651.924
Engine displacement 2143 cm3 (130.77 cu. in.)
Number of cylinders 4
Engine configuration Inline
Cylinder Bore 83 mm (3.27 in.)
Piston Stroke 99 mm (3.9 in.)
Compression ratio 16.2:1
Number of valves per cylinder 4
Fuel injection system Diesel Commonrail
Engine aspiration BiTurbo, Intercooler
Valvetrain DOHC
Engine oil capacity 6.5 l (6.87 US qt | 5.72 UK qt)
Coolant 9 l (9.51 US qt | 7.92 UK qt)
Kerb Weight 1770 kg (3902.18 lbs.)
Max. weight 2440 kg (5379.28 lbs.)
Max load 670 kg (1477.1 lbs.)
Trunk (boot) space – minimum 695 l (24.54 cu. ft.)
Trunk (boot) space – maximum 1950 l (68.86 cu. ft.)
Fuel tank capacity 59 l (15.59 US gal | 12.98 UK gal)
Max. roof load 100 kg (220.46 lbs.)
Permitted trailer load with brakes (12%) 1900 kg (4188.78 lbs.)
Permitted trailer load without brakes 750 kg (1653.47 lbs.)
Permitted towbar download 84 kg (185.19 lbs.)
Length 4895 mm (192.72 in.)
Width 1854 mm (72.99 in.)
Width including mirrors 2071 mm (81.54 in.)
Height 1512 mm (59.53 in.)
Wheelbase 2874 mm (113.15 in.)
Front track 1585 mm (62.4 in.)
Rear track 1604 mm (63.15 in.)
Front overhang 841 mm (33.11 in.)
Rear overhang 1180 mm (46.46 in.)
Drag coefficient (Cd) 0.29
Minimum turning circle 11.25 m (36.91 ft.)
Drivetrain Architecture Rear wheel drive
Number of gears 6
Type of gearbox Manual transmission
Front suspension Coil spring, Independent multi-link suspension, Transverse stabilizer, Air Suspension – Optional
Rear suspension Independent multi-link suspension, Air suspension, Transverse stabilizer
Front brakes Ventilated discs, 322 mm
Rear brakes Disc, 300 mm

Powertrain & Engine Architecture

The E 250 CDI BlueEFFICIENCY was powered by the OM651.924, a 2.1-liter inline-four cylinder diesel engine. This engine was a cornerstone of Mercedes-Benz’s diesel offerings, known for its robust construction and efficiency. It featured a sophisticated common-rail direct injection system, delivering fuel at extremely high pressure for optimized combustion. The engine employed a bi-turbocharger setup – a smaller turbocharger for quick response at low engine speeds and a larger turbocharger for increased power at higher RPMs. An intercooler further enhanced performance by cooling the compressed intake air. The engine boasted a high compression ratio of 16.2:1, contributing to its thermal efficiency. The 6-speed manual transmission was standard, providing precise gear changes and contributing to the vehicle’s overall fuel economy. The Start & Stop system automatically shut off the engine when the vehicle was stationary, further reducing fuel consumption and emissions.

Driving Characteristics

The E 250 CDI T-modell offered a comfortable and refined driving experience. While not overtly sporty, the 204 horsepower and 368 lb-ft of torque provided ample power for everyday driving and long-distance cruising. Acceleration from 0-60 mph took approximately 7.4 seconds, making it competitive within its class. The manual transmission allowed for driver engagement, while the well-tuned suspension provided a smooth ride. Compared to higher-output E-Class variants like the E 350, the E 250 CDI prioritized fuel efficiency over outright performance. The gear ratios were optimized for fuel economy, meaning the engine sometimes felt slightly strained when accelerating hard in higher gears. However, the abundant low-end torque made it a capable and relaxed highway cruiser.

Equipment & Trim Levels

The E 250 CDI BlueEFFICIENCY T-modell came standard with a comprehensive array of features, including automatic climate control, power windows and mirrors, a multi-function steering wheel, and a high-quality audio system. Interior upholstery typically consisted of fabric or Artico leatherette. Optional extras included leather upholstery, a sunroof, navigation system, parking sensors, and advanced driver-assistance systems like lane keeping assist and blind spot monitoring. Trim levels were relatively streamlined, with most customization options available as individual add-ons rather than distinct packages.

Chassis & Braking

The S212 E-Class T-modell featured a robust chassis with a multi-link independent suspension at both the front and rear. This suspension design provided excellent ride comfort and handling characteristics. The front suspension incorporated coil springs, while the rear suspension often included optional air suspension for adjustable ride height and improved comfort. Braking duties were handled by ventilated discs at the front and solid discs at the rear. Anti-lock braking system (ABS) was standard, ensuring safe and controlled stopping power. The steering system was a hydraulic power-assisted rack and pinion setup, providing precise and responsive steering feel.

Market Reception & Comparison

The E 250 CDI BlueEFFICIENCY T-modell was well-received by critics for its combination of practicality, efficiency, and refinement. It was praised for its spacious interior, comfortable ride, and strong fuel economy. Compared to the E 350 T-modell, the E 250 CDI offered a more affordable entry point into the E-Class estate range, while still providing a premium driving experience. The diesel engine’s fuel economy was a significant advantage, particularly for drivers who covered long distances. However, some critics noted that the engine lacked the outright performance of its gasoline-powered counterparts.

Legacy

The OM651 engine family, including the OM651.924 found in the E 250 CDI, has proven to be remarkably durable and reliable. With proper maintenance, these engines can easily exceed 200,000 miles. The E 250 CDI T-modell remains a popular choice in the used car market, particularly for buyers seeking a practical and fuel-efficient estate car. Common maintenance items include regular oil changes, filter replacements, and occasional attention to the diesel particulate filter (DPF). The S212 E-Class T-modell, in general, is regarded as a well-built and reliable vehicle, making the E 250 CDI a sensible and rewarding purchase for discerning buyers.
